Output 59ebbc17696b89bf2e85cd39ff7edf68c1cb3fb903980a001a3cb10dc97db45e:0

value
3308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 74db969586393f0f1181840e5286253acd9d71ffbb71a3060a93389ae717f938
address
ltc1pwnded9vx8yls7yvpss899p398txe6u0lhdc6xps2jvuf4echlyuqxn92hq
transaction
59ebbc17696b89bf2e85cd39ff7edf68c1cb3fb903980a001a3cb10dc97db45e
spent
true